Ukraine Sends Ex-SBU Cybersecurity Chief's Illicit Enrichment Case to Court

Investigators say the former SBU cybersecurity chief hid the source of funds for a Hr 21.6 million apartment and filed false declaration data.

Ukraine’s National Anti-Corruption Bureau (NABU) and Specialized Anti-Corruption Prosecutor’s Office (SAPO) have sent to court a case against a former head of the Security Service of Ukraine’s (SBU) Cybersecurity Department. He is accused of illicit enrichment and filing false information in an asset declaration, NABU said on Sept. 2. Law enforcement officials did not name the defendant, but according to Bihus.Info, the case concerns Illia Vitiu…

This was reported by the press services of NABU and the SAP. According to the materials of the pre-trial investigation of the NABU, the prosecutor of the NABU sent an indictment in this case to the High Anti-Corruption Court. The pre-trial investigation found that in December 2023 the official purchased an apartment for 21.6 million UAH and issued her on a family member. At the same time, according to the contract, its value is UAH 12.8 million.…
